The Lupus Site

Joanne Forshaw launched the popular website www.uklupus.co.uk after she was diagnosed with lupus in 1996 when she was 20. Her website provides information and support for people with the disease.

Program objectives:
  1. Provide everything you need to know about lupus by a lupus sufferer.
  2. Help make sufferers' lives easier.

Joanne started her website to help other people with the condition and because she “sat at home all day, exhausted, with nothing to do.”

The site is based largely on the book Understanding Lupus, by Dr. Graham Hughes, head of the Lupus Research Unit at St Thomas's Hospital, London.
